#Banner {
	clear:both;
	background:#BA0202 url(../images/bannerBg.png) no-repeat 50% 0;
	border-top:1px solid #980000;
	border-bottom:1px solid #980000;
	text-align:center;
	margin:20px 0;
	padding:20px 0 10px;
}
	#Banner h1 {
		color:#fff;
	}
	#Banner p, #Banner a, #Banner a:visited {
		color:#fff;
	}
#GreyBanner {
	clear:both;
	background:#efeef3;
	border-top:1px solid #b5b5b5;
	border-bottom:1px solid #b5b5b5;
	margin:20px 0;
	padding:10px 0;
}
#logo {
	margin-top:10px;
}
#socialMedia {
	margin:40px 0 0;
}

.clear {
	clear:both;
}
.floatLeft {
	float:left;
}

.floatRight {
	float:right;
}

.formBoxTop {
	margin:10px auto;
	background:#cc0000 url(../images/formTop.png) no-repeat;
	width:279px;
}
	.formBox {
		background: url(../images/formBottom.png) no-repeat left bottom;
		padding:10px;
	}
		.formBox h3 {
			color:#fff!important;
			font-size:20px!important;
			text-align:center;
			padding-top: 10px;
		}
	
	
.grid_8 img {
	border: 5px solid #CCC!important;
	}

.formBox label {
	display: none!important;
	}
	
.flickrBoxTop {
	margin:10px auto;
	background:#e8e8e8 url(../images/flickrTop.png) no-repeat;
	width:279px;
}
	.flickrBox {
		background: url(../images/flickrBottom.png) no-repeat left bottom;
		padding:10px;
		text-align: center;
	}
		.flickrBox h3 {
			color:#000!important;
			font-size:20px!important;
			text-align:center;
			padding-top: 10px;
		}
		
		.flickrBox table {
			margin: 0 auto!important;
			}
		
		.flickrBox td {
			border: none!important;
			padding: 1px!important;
			}
	
		.flickrBox p {
		vertical-align: middle;
		margin: 0 auto!important;
	
			}